    Best Non-Surgical Facelift for Jowls: Ultherapy vs. Thermage

    When it comes to achieving a youthful appearance and combating the sagging of jowls, many individuals are turning to non-surgical solutions. Among the most popular treatments are Ultherapy and Thermage, both of which offer effective results without the need for invasive surgery. In this article, we will compare Ultherapy and Thermage to determine which is the best non-surgical facelift for jowls.

    Understanding Ultherapy and Thermage

    Before diving into a comparison, it’s essential to understand how Ultherapy and Thermage work. Both treatments aim to address the issue of sagging jowls by stimulating the body’s natural collagen production, but they use different technologies to achieve their results.

    Ultherapy

    Ultherapy is a non-surgical facelift technique that utilizes high-intensity focused ultrasound (HIFU) to target the deeper layers of the skin. By delivering ultrasound energy to specific depths, Ultherapy stimulates the production of collagen and elastin, which are crucial for skin firmness and elasticity. This treatment is known for its ability to lift and tighten the skin, making it a strong contender for the best non-surgical facelift for jowls.

    Key Benefits of Ultherapy:

    • Precision: Targets deeper layers of the skin with ultrasound energy.
    • No Downtime: Minimal recovery time, with most patients resuming normal activities immediately.
    • Long-Lasting Results: Collagen stimulation leads to gradual improvement over several months.
    • FDA Approved: Clinically tested and approved for lifting and tightening.

    Thermage

    Thermage is another popular non-surgical facelift option that uses radiofrequency (RF) technology. By applying RF energy to the skin’s surface, Thermage heats the deeper layers, which encourages the production of new collagen and tightens existing collagen fibers. This process helps to lift and firm the skin, making Thermage a viable option for treating jowls.

    Key Benefits of Thermage:

    • Comprehensive Treatment: Provides an overall tightening effect by heating multiple layers of the skin.
    • Single Session: Typically requires only one session to see results, although some patients may benefit from additional treatments.
    • Minimal Discomfort: Most patients experience only minor discomfort during the procedure.
    • FDA Cleared: Proven effective for skin tightening and contouring.

    Ultherapy vs. Thermage: Which Is the Best Non-Surgical Facelift for Jowls?

    When determining the best non-surgical facelift for jowls, it’s important to compare the strengths and considerations of Ultherapy and Thermage:

    Effectiveness

    Both Ultherapy and Thermage are effective in stimulating collagen production and improving skin laxity. However, Ultherapy is often preferred for its precision in targeting specific layers of the skin, which can be beneficial for lifting and tightening jowls.

    Thermage, while also effective, provides a more generalized tightening effect. It may be better suited for patients seeking overall skin rejuvenation rather than targeted jowl treatment.

    Treatment Experience

    Ultherapy involves the application of ultrasound energy, which can sometimes cause a sensation of warmth or tingling. Thermage uses radiofrequency energy, which generally feels like a warming sensation. Both treatments are well-tolerated, but patient preference may vary based on comfort levels.

    Results and Recovery

    Ultherapy results typically develop gradually over a few months as collagen production increases. Thermage results can also be gradual but may become noticeable sooner after treatment. Both procedures require minimal downtime, with patients usually returning to their daily activities immediately.

    Cost and Number of Sessions

    Ultherapy and Thermage vary in cost depending on the area treated and the number of sessions required. Ultherapy may require multiple sessions for optimal results, whereas Thermage often provides satisfactory outcomes with a single session. The overall cost will depend on individual treatment plans and geographic location.

    Conclusion

    In conclusion, both Ultherapy and Thermage are excellent choices for a non-surgical facelift, particularly when it comes to addressing jowls. Each treatment has its unique benefits, and the best non-surgical facelift for jowls will depend on your specific needs and preferences. Ultherapy offers precise targeting with ultrasound energy, while Thermage provides overall tightening with radiofrequency. Consulting with a qualified aesthetic professional can help determine which option is best suited for achieving your desired results and rejuvenating your appearance.
